WebSep 27, 2024 · Deep Pressure Stimulation (DPS), is a tactile stimulation provided as gentle pressure to the body via tugging, stroking, cuddling or wrapping, that relaxes the nervous system. It can be applied through different devices: massage tools, hands, swaddles, or Psychiatric Service Dogs, specially trained to provide deep pressure therapy. Occupational therapists who work with hyperactive children and adults who are in an aroused state sometimes employ deep pressure touch (DPT) as a therapeutic method to achieve calmer behavior. This pilot study attempts to measure effects of DPT on objective and subjective anxiety.
